Paessler PRTG features and specs

  • Comprehensive Monitoring
    PRTG provides a wide array of monitoring capabilities, including bandwidth, network, server, and application monitoring, delivering a holistic view of the entire IT infrastructure.
  • User-Friendly Interface
    The platform offers a clean, intuitive interface with powerful visualization tools such as dashboards and maps that make it easier to manage and interpret the monitored data.
  • Customization and Flexibility
    PRTG allows a high degree of customization with flexible sensor configurations and custom alerting rules, adapting easily to diverse monitoring requirements.
  • Scalability
    PRTG is designed to scale from small businesses to large enterprises, making it a suitable solution for growing IT environments.
  • Detailed Reporting
    The software provides extensive reporting features that help in performance tracking, trend analysis, and compliance, aiding better decision-making.

Possible disadvantages of Paessler PRTG

  • Steep Learning Curve
    Although the interface is user-friendly, the extensive range of features and customization options can initially overwhelm new users, requiring a significant investment in learning time.
  • Resource Intensive
    PRTG can be resource-intensive, potentially impacting the performance of the machines on which it is installed, especially in larger or more complex setups.
  • Cost
    While the basic version is free, the cost can quickly escalate with licensing fees for additional sensors, becoming expensive for larger organizations.
  • Alert Noise
    The alerting system can generate high volumes of alerts, which might include false positives, leading to 'alert fatigue' and possibly desensitizing administrators to critical alerts.
  • Limited Third-Party Integrations
    PRTG's integration capabilities with third-party tools are not as extensive as some competitors, potentially limiting its interoperability within a broader IT ecosystem.

Socket for Python features and specs

  • Security Focus
    Socket provides a primary emphasis on security, offering tools and features that help developers secure their Python applications and dependencies against various vulnerabilities.
  • Dependency Analysis
    The platform offers thorough analysis of dependencies, allowing developers to understand the security posture of third-party packages in their projects and manage them accordingly.
  • Ease of Integration
    Socket is designed to integrate seamlessly into existing Python development workflows, minimizing disruptions while enhancing security.
  • Real-time Monitoring
    Socket allows for real-time monitoring of package security, giving developers immediate alerts about newly discovered vulnerabilities or issues in their dependencies.

Possible disadvantages of Socket for Python

  • Learning Curve
    Developers new to security-focused tools might face a learning curve in understanding how to fully leverage Socket's features and capabilities.
  • Platform Limitations
    As with any tool, Socket may have limitations in compatibility with certain Python environments or frameworks, which could pose challenges for some projects.
  • Dependency on Tool
    Relying heavily on Socket for security may lead to a dependency on the platform, which could be a concern if there are outages or changes in support.
  • Possible Performance Overheads
    The security checks and real-time monitoring features, while beneficial, might introduce some performance overheads in the development process.

HWMonitor Review & Alternatives for 2023
Paessler PRTG Network Monitor is a network monitoring tool that can also monitor hardware. With PRTG Network Monitor you can monitor the CPU, RAM, and hard drives of network devices. Devices that the tool monitors include computers, switches, routers, and printers. The tool pings devices in your network to assess response time and availability. The tool is thus a good choice...
